### Data-Centre Cage Visits — Night Shift

Night-shift engineers visiting the Dunmere Hall data centre must book cage access through the shift supervisor at least two hours ahead. Sign in at the loading-bay desk, collect a visitor lanyard, and remain within your assigned cage row. Tools must be logged in and out. Photography is not permitted on the floor. Once booked, proceed to the cage corridor and enter the access code below at the inner door.

badge for hahip-bagag: bdg-FIJ-9

During your first week at Drossel Point, contractors on the night shift must sign in at the loading-dock office before 22:00 and confirm their work zone with the duty supervisor. Hard hats and high-visibility vests are mandatory past the plant corridor. Lone working is not permitted in the sub-basement. To reach the night office, use the pass code below.

badge for kawif-yahif: bdg-CLP-1

## Runbook: Ledgerfall monthly partitions

The Ledgerfall billing tables are partitioned by calendar month. A scheduled job creates next month's partition on the 25th; if it fails, inserts on the 1st will error. Support should verify the upcoming partition exists before escalating. The partition manager reads its settings at startup, and the current values are shown here.

config for yajep-tafof:
[rusath]
team = julmir
access_code = ac_fe37fd
host = rusath.novactech.test
port = 8000
owner = pelmir.weneth
peer = oliwyn.olvarqdyn.internal

## Service Accounts — Dedupely Plugin Access

Hey plugin authors! Dedupely collapses duplicate on-call alerts before they hit pagers, and your plugins talk to it through the `plugin-gateway` service account. Keep requests under 50/min or the gateway throttles you. Each plugin sandbox gets the shared staging credential rather than its own. Authenticate your test harness with the key below.

API key for yahig-tadup: kto7_ubizbYm